What is rhetoric?

Back

Rhetoric is the art of effective or persuasive speaking or writing, often using figures of speech and other compositional techniques.

What are the three main types of rhetorical appeals?

Back

The three main types of rhetorical appeals are ethos (credibility), pathos (emotion), and logos (logic).

Define ethos in rhetoric.

Back

Ethos is a rhetorical appeal to credibility or character, often established by the speaker's authority or trustworthiness.

Define pathos in rhetoric.

Back

Pathos is a rhetorical appeal to emotion, aiming to persuade an audience by eliciting feelings.

Define logos in rhetoric.

Back

Logos is a rhetorical appeal to logic and reason, using facts, statistics, and logical arguments to persuade.
